Formal Languages And Automata Theory Ck Nagpal Pdf Top Direct
This is often the hardest concept for beginners. Use Nagpal's step-by-step breakdowns to understand how to prove a language is not regular or context-free.
Formal Languages and Automata Theory by , published by Oxford University Press , is widely considered an excellent introductory textbook for undergraduate Computer Science (CSE/IT) and MCA students. Key Highlights
The book follows a logical progression from fundamental mathematical structures to advanced complexity theory: Fundamentals & Preliminaries : Chapters 1 and 2 cover the basics of formal languages formal languages and automata theory ck nagpal pdf top
by Chander Kumar Nagpal (Oxford University Press) is widely recognized as one of the most accessible textbooks for mastering the Theory of Computation (TOC). For undergraduate and postgraduate computer science students engineering their way through complex systems, this book bridges the gap between abstract mathematical concepts and practical engineering applications. Finding a high-quality guide or PDF summary of this text helps learners conquer core computer science challenges like compiler design, natural language processing, and complexity analysis. Key Information Overview
The book starts with prerequisites like discrete mathematical structures before moving into deterministic and nondeterministic finite automata (DFA/NFA). Comprehensive Coverage: This is often the hardest concept for beginners
Do you need help solving a specific ?
: You can find both physical and digital details on the Amazon Product Page . Formal Languages and Automata Theory - Amazon.com Key Highlights The book follows a logical progression
Automata theory relies heavily on set theory, mathematical induction, and graph principles. Nagpal dedicates the opening chapters to these basics. This foundation ensures readers can interpret formal proofs, 5-tuple machine definitions, and state transition functions without confusion. 2. Finite Automata (FA) and Regular Expressions
: Unlike many dense theoretical texts, Nagpal incorporates a large number of solved examples to help students bridge the gap between abstract theory and practical problem-solving.
[Chomsky Hierarchy of Languages & Automata] +----------------------------------+ | Type-0: Recursively Enumerable | --> Turing Machine (TM) | +--------------------------+ | | | Type-1: Context-Sensitive| | --> Linear-Bounded Automata (LBA) | | +------------------+ | | | | | Type-2: CFG | | | --> Pushdown Automata (PDA) | | | +----------+ | | | | | | | Type-3 | | | | --> Finite Automata (DFA/NFA) | | | | Regular | | | | +---+---+---+----------+---+---+---+ 1. Mathematical Preliminaries & Foundations
The most straightforward way is to buy the book. The paperback is widely available in India and online through retailers like Flipkart (priced at approximately ₹642), Amazon, and the Oxford University Press India website (listed at ₹675 INR).